March 18, 2007

STATESBORO, GA. —The South Carolina men’s golf team turned in its best performance of the season, finishing fourth among an 18-team Schenkel E-Z-Go Invitational field on Sunday at Forest Heights Country Club (Par 72, 6,692 yards) in Statesboro, Ga. Sophomore Baker Elmore (Cheraw, S.C.) placed in a tie for fourth individually, the best performance of his career, to lead the Gamecocks.

Carolina entered Sunday’s final round in second place and shot a team total of 296 in Sunday’s final round, putting them at 10-over par for the tournament (295-283-296=874). The Gamecocks beat eight teams ranked in Golfstat’s top 50, including No. 7 Florida, No. 12 Texas A&M, No. 13 Tennessee, No. 15 North Carolina and No. 19 Minnesota, and finished in the top five for seventh time at the Schenkel.

Southeastern Conference teams dominated the field. Consensus top-five team Georgia (287-277-290=854) claimed the team title, No. 2 Alabama (292-288-280=860) placed second and No. 25 Auburn (289-293-286-868) finished third.

Elmore capped the weekend with a 74 on the final 18 holes. After playing 16 holes at one-under, Elmore suffered a triple bogey on 17 and recovered to make par on 18. Georgia’s Chris Kirk captured individual medalist honors after carding a six-under par 210. Teammate Brendon Todd was two strokes behind Kirk to finish in second place (212) and Alabama’s Michael Thompson (213) place third.

Gamecock sophomore Allen Koon (Bamberg, S.C.) also posted his best career finish by tying for 19th. Koon shot a final-round 76 and wrapped up the tournament three-over par with a total score of 73-70-76=219.

Freshman George Bryan IV (Chapin, S.C.) was two strokes back of Koon and shared 27th place. Bryan fired a 74 on the final 18 holes to finish at 76-71-74=221 (+5). Junior Warren Thomas (Columbia, S.C.) logged his third straight round of 74 and tied for 31st at six-over par while junior Mark Anderson (Beaufort, S.C.) also shot 74 on Sunday and placed in a tie for 41st.

The Gamecocks return to action March 25-27 when they participate in the Hootie at Bulls Bay Intercollegiate, played at Bulls Bay Golf Club in Awendaw, S.C.
